Siegel Cooper and Company

Layout of the Siegel, Cooper and Company Department Store, Chicago Tribune, 6 March 1892.

Quotation from A Parisienne in Chicago:

You can find everything in these stores. In the basement there is a butcher shop and a grocery store. On the ground floor, counters display every imaginable product. The fresh fruit section displays its oranges, pineapples, and bananas right next to the shoe department. The candy section is next to the silky fabrics while the jewelry department faces the spot where all sorts of liquors including whisky, rum, champagne and wines from France, Germany and Spain are found.
